The South Korea analog valve positioners market has demonstrated steady growth driven by the country’s robust industrial base, technological advancement, and increasing automation adoption across key sectors such as petrochemicals, power generation, and manufacturing. As of 2023, the market size is estimated at approximately USD 150 million, with a projected comp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 5.8% over the next five years (2024–2028). This growth trajectory is predicated on several assumptions, including sustained industrial expansion, ongoing digital transformation initiatives, and regulatory support for safety and efficiency standards. Based on these assumptions, the market is expected to reach approximately USD 200 million by 2028. The CAGR reflects a balanced interplay of mature industrial demand, incremental technological upgrades, and emerging opportunities in niche applications such as retrofitting legacy systems with analog control solutions.

Technological Advancements

While digital positioners are gaining prominence, analog positioners remain vital in legacy systems due to their simplicity, reliability, and cost-effectiveness. Innovations such as enhanced calibration features and integration capabilities are extending their lifecycle and operational efficiency.

Digital Transformation & Industry Standards

The market is increasingly influenced by digital transformation trends, including system integration, interoperability standards (such as FOUNDATION Fieldbus, HART), and Industry 4.0 protocols. Analog positioners are now often integrated into hybrid control architectures, enabling seamless operation alongside digital systems. Cross-industry collaborations are fostering innovation, with partnerships between control system providers and valve manufacturers to develop integrated solutions that combine analog reliability with digital intelligence. These collaborations are vital for retrofitting existing plants and designing future-proof systems.

Adoption Trends & End-User Insights

Major end-user segments exhibit distinct adoption patterns: – **Oil & Gas:** Preference for proven analog solutions in hazardous zones; retrofitting legacy assets remains a priority. – **Power Sector:** Gradual shift towards digital, but analog remains dominant in critical safety applications. – **Chemical & Petrochemical:** Emphasis on reliability; analog positioners preferred for critical control loops. – **Water & Wastewater:** Growing adoption driven by infrastructure upgrades, with a focus on cost-effective analog solutions. Real-world use cases include retrofitting aging control systems in South Korea’s petrochemical plants, where analog positioners provide a cost-effective upgrade path without extensive system overhaul.
